Fire damage can be devastating, leaving behind a trail of destruction that requires professional cleaning and restoration. In Lewisville, TX, the cost of fire damage cleaning can vary widely based on several factors. Understanding these factors can help homeowners and businesses better prepare for the financial implications of such an unfortunate event.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Extent of Damage: The severity and spread of the fire damage will significantly influence the overall cost.
  • Type of Materials Damaged: Different materials, such as wood, metal, or fabric, have varying cleaning and restoration costs.
  • Size of Affected Area: Larger areas will naturally require more resources and time, increasing the cost.
  • Required Specialized Equipment: The need for specialized equipment like ozone machines or thermal foggers can add to the expense.
  • Labor Costs: The number of professionals needed and the duration of the cleanup will affect the total cost.
  • Post-Cleanup Repairs: Any necessary repairs after the initial cleaning phase will also contribute to the overall cost.
  • Location-Specific Factors: Local regulations and the availability of services in Lewisville, TX, can impact the pricing.

Common Tasks and Costs

Task Average Cost in Lewisville, TX
Initial Assessment $200 - $400
Smoke and Soot Removal $2,000 - $6,000
Water Damage Mitigation $1,000 - $4,500
Structural Cleaning $3,000 - $7,500
Odor Removal $1,000 - $3,000
Full Restoration Services $10,000 - $30,000
